Kagi News API Documentation

This API is currently in beta. We strive to keep the API stable, but as we're actively developing new features, some changes may occur. We'll document any breaking changes in the changelog below.

The data provided by this API is licensed under CC BY-NC 4.0
  • Free to use for non-commercial purposes with attribution
  • Commercial licensing available - contact support@kagi.com

We'd love to see what you build with Kagi News data. Feel free to share your projects with us!

Already using Kagi News/Kite data?

If you're currently reading from kite.json files, check out our migration guide.

View Migration Guide

OpenAPI Specification

Import our API into your favorite tools like Postman, Insomnia, or code generators.

GET /api/openapi
View OpenAPI JSON

Changelog

2025-01-10 UTC Enhancement

Dedicated image fields for stories

  • New fields: primary_image and secondary_image (replacing ad-hoc selection from article images)
  • Structure: { url, caption, credit? }
  • Older stories won't be migrated to use these fields

More API changes and updates will be documented here as they occur.